Mary drove to the mountains last weekend. There was heavy traffic on the way there, and the trip took 7 hours. When Mary drove h

ome, there was no traffic and the trip only took 4 hours. If her average rate was 27 miles per hour faster on the trip home, how far away does Mary live from the mountains? Do not do any rounding.

There are two separate equations for this question that use the same variable.

Mary took 7 hours to complete a trip with traffic. This would use the following expression:

7x

Mary took 4 hours to complete the same trip without traffic. The average rate of speed was 27 mph faster than the trip with traffic. This uses the following expression:

4(x+27)

Both trips had the same distance. From the information provided, we can set up the following equation:

7x = 4(x+27)

x represents the average rate of speed on both trips.

Distribute 4 to each term in parentheses:

4 \times x = 4x
4 \times 27 = 108

7x = 4x + 108

Subtract 4x from both sides:

3x = 108

Divide both sides by 3 to get x by itself:

x = 36

The average speed for the slower trip is 36 mph.

We can plug this value into the first equation:

7(36) = 7 \times 36 = 252

Mary lives 252 miles away from the mountains.
